Choosing the right wedding shoe is an important step in wedding planning. You can’t just go into a store and choose the one that is the most eye-catching. When choosing, you also need to consider certain practical aspects. Some references below should help.

Comfort and fit

When choosing a shoe, you should not sacrifice comfort. And you have all the more reasons to choose the most comfortable one that suits you perfectly when it comes to a very special day in your life.

Heel height

Given the choice, you’d immediately think of wearing one of those sexy looking 7 to 8 inch heel shoes, right? Better said than done. Imagine having to stay in these shoes for a couple of hours. Walk down the hallway with absolute ease and comfort when 200 eyes are on you.

The nervousness of the big day is too great. So why not let your beautiful feet be happy all the time while dealing with as much balance as a bride should? Better go for a medium heel (4 to 5 inches) that is super comfortable and lets your feet breathe too. Block heels with glitter are pretty trendy these days if you want to try something different. Otherwise, the classic high heels are always there for you and offer hundreds of different options.
